IGA-3000 Array Detectors

Spectrum One InGaAs Array Detectors:

As the semiconductor and telecommunications industries continue to become more sophisticated, there is an increasing interest in the NIR region of the spectrum for characterization of optical fibers, light sources, semiconductors and other related materials. In order to cover such applications, Jobin Yvon has developed the IGA-3000 linear array family utilizing very low noise detectors optimized for the Spectroscopic measurements.

The Array for IR Spectroscopy

The new IGA-3000 series detectors feature spectroscopic-grade InGaAs (Indium-Galium-Arsenide) linear arrays with 25 x 500 micron or 50 x 500 micron pixel elements. IGA-3000 array detectors offer extremely high sensitivity, dynamic range, signal-to-noise performance and stability for NIR applications. They provide a tremendous multiplexing advantage over single channel NIR detectors, without the need for an optical chopper . The small pixels and a maximum of 85% quantum efficiency make them ideal for spectroscopic analysis: the signal produced from the spectrograph is detected without loss of the spectral information.
